Nursing Braclet


This is my new favorite baby shower gift. I got the idea from Nanny Goat. It has the hours 1-12 and three beads between each number, representing fifteen minutes, you just move the clip to the time you last nursed. I think it is a cute idea! You can also use it to keep track of how many diapers your baby goes through a day or last time you gave them medicine, if they are sick. It was really easy to make just get memory wire, number beads, beads, a clip and charm. The hard thing for me to find was the number beads. I had to get them in Indianapolis (50 miles away). But you can probably find them online too, Alpha Beads makes them. All my supplies coast $12 and I was able to make four before I ran out of number 1 beads. You can also buy them on Ebay but they sell for $15-$20. Plus it's more fun to make your own.
